今天是第 19 天,要來寫的題目是 Palindrome Number 那麼話不多說,我們就開始吧 ─=≡Σ(((っ›´ω`‹ )っ!

今天要刷的題目是 Leetcode Easy – twoSum!(登燈) 先來看看題目: Input: nums = [2,7,11,15], target = 9 Output: [0,1] Output: Because nums[0] + nums[1] == 9, we return [0, 1].

panic 雖然說是例外處理,但其實 Go 並沒有真的拋出例外的機制,而是透過 panic 來讓當前執行的程式碼中斷流程。

channel 昨天在介紹 goroutine 有提到,當 main goroutine 結束時,其他的 goroutine 也會跟著結束,要怎麼讓 main goroutine 知道其他 goroutine 的狀況,就能夠透過 channel 來進行不同 goroutine 之間的交流以及資訊傳遞。

事前提要:必須先瞭解 thread 是什麼!